// Heads up for the weekly sync: BRAMBLE_UI_VERSION pins which cut of
// the Bramble shared component library every app pulls. Don't bump it
// casually — the datepicker API changed in 4.x and the Tidemark team
// got burned last quarter. Bump here, run the visual diff suite, then
// post in the sync thread. The token for the currently pinned build
// sits on the next line.

build token for kagaf-hahof: htk14_9d3d4d26d7d8de

# Break-glass: TimeLoom Solver

Break-glass access applies when the TimeLoom school timetable solver wedges mid-term and normal admin auth is down. Reviewers: confirm any break-glass change is paired with an audit entry in solver-ops/log. Access grants expire after 60 minutes; do not extend. Escalate to the Fennwick duty lead first. Once approved, unlock the break-glass console with the recovery passphrase below.

unlock words, yawig-kagef: gordor-holvan-ulaael-pramir-ulaiel-tamdor

## Tuning the Partner SFTP Drop

Quick notes before you cut the release: the Marlowe Exchange partner drop is picky. Files land in bursts around midnight their time, so the poller needs a tight interval during that window and a lazy one otherwise. Keep the concurrent-transfer cap modest — their server throttles hard past four streams, and retries just make it worse. Everything here is overridable per environment, nothing baked in. The defaults we ship with are listed below.

tuning table, yajog-yahof:
BUDGETS = {
    "lamvan": 303,
    "wenox": 460,
    "fenvan": 525,
}